Can’t speak for large scale sites with abundant volcanic activity… But for residential geothermal the bore hole has a lifetime based on how much ground water there is and how active usage it sees.
This is because using it cools the hole slowly and after a few decades (depending on how quickly ground water can dissipate heat gradient) a new hole need to be drilled a distance away.
Can we cycle the holes? Use one while the other one is warming back up.